Step into the nostalgic atmosphere of Kashiya Yokocho, a charming alley lined with traditional sweet shops.
This area has preserved the retro spirit of old Japan and offers a glimpse into local confectionery culture. It’s a perfect place to enjoy classic Japanese snacks and experience the warm, traditional side of Kawagoe.
Explore Kawagoe Ichibangai, the town’s most iconic street, known for its beautifully preserved warehouse-style buildings with black plaster walls.
Often called “Little Edo,” this area reflects the atmosphere of Japan’s Edo period. Kawagoe, known as 'Little Edo', is a charming city in Saitama Prefecture with a rich history and well-preserved Edo-period architecture. Its historic district, Kurazukuri, features beautiful clay-walled warehouses and traditional streets that transport visitors back in time.
